Girgasite is the ancestral name of a Canaanite people descended from Canaan. The page uses a person-style entry because the dataset preserves ethnonyms in genealogical form. First appears in Gen 10:16.1

Dwelling in clayey soil, the descendants of the fifth son of Canaan (Gen. 10:16), one of the original tribes inhabiting the land of Canaan before the time of the Israelites (Gen. 15:21; Deut. 7:1). They were a branch of the great family of the Hivites. Of their geographical position nothing is certainly known. Probably they lived somewhere in the central part of Western Palestine. 3
